WebInherited disorders can arise when chromosomes behave abnormally during meiosis. Chromosome disorders can be divided into two categories: abnormalities in chromosome number and chromosome structural rearrangements. WebThe pairing of homologous chromosomes after DNA replication is not only a key event underlying meiotic chromosome segregation, but also allows recombination between chromosomes of paternal and maternal origin.
